Q: Is 33,133,210 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 33,133,210 is not a prime number.

Why is 33,133,210 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 33133210 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 11 22 55 110 301,211 602,422 1,506,055 3,012,110 3,313,321 6,626,642 16,566,605 and 33,133,210, with no remainder.

Since 33,133,210 cannot be divided by just 1 and 33,133,210, it is not a prime number.
